General Starhawk Beta Tips
- Kill to build, build to kill. Kill enemies to get more Rift Energy to build more stuff to kill more enemies.
- Shoot glowing Rift barrels to collect more Rift Energy.
- Do not repeatedly build the same structures. Things like Garages or Launch Pads allow you to create new vehicles without building a new structure.
- If you stay in the vicinity of your base area and Rift Extractor you will auto-magically collect Rift energy.
- Each structure does something specific. Discover its purpose!
- Most all the structures have a glowing yellow panel. If you go up to one, you will be prompted to either create a new vehicle or remove the building. Removing repeated buildings is a great way to ease the strain on your structure cap.

- Pick your Skill wisely. You can also change them during a match during respawn. Remember that you need enough XP points and the listed prerequisite for a Skill to unlock.
